🔑 Enhanced Key Takeaways

  • OpenClaw reached 190,000+ GitHub stars by mid-February 2026, becoming the 21st most popular repository ever, demonstrating unprecedented adoption velocity for an AI agent framework[6]
  • The platform's architecture prioritizes file-based systems over traditional databases, with vector database consolidation for long-term memory, representing a novel approach to AI application layer design that avoids fine-tuning proprietary models[4]
  • OpenClaw founder was hired by OpenAI as of February 20, 2026, signaling major industry validation and potential strategic implications for the open-source project's future direction[8]

🛠️ Technical Deep Dive

Architecture

  • File-based core architecture rather than schema-first database design[4]
  • Vector database integration for persistent memory and learning across sessions[1]
  • Multi-model support allowing users to leverage Claude, ChatGPT, Gemini, Grok, or other underlying LLMs[6]

Capabilities

  • Local execution on macOS, Windows/WSL2, or Linux with direct data control[1]
  • Task automation including reminders, file management, web scraping, form filling, and data extraction[1]
  • Multi-platform messaging integration (WhatsApp, Telegram, iMessage, Discord, Slack)[1]
  • Configurable system prompts and max token settings for model behavior control[3]
  • OCR capability for receipt and document processing[2]

Deployment

  • Local development setup and cloud VPS/production deployment options[5]
  • Docker containerization for scalable deployments[5]
  • API integration for global and frontend connectivity[5]

Timeline

2026-01
OpenClaw launched in late January 2026 by Peter Steinberger; reached 100,000 GitHub stars within seven days[1]
2026-02
OpenClaw accumulated 190,000+ GitHub stars by mid-February, ranking as 21st most popular repository ever on GitHub[6]
2026-02
OpenClaw founder hired by OpenAI as of February 20, 2026[8]
